BIO

Abhay Parekh received a B.E.S. in Mathematical Sciences from Johns Hopkins University in 1983, a S.M. in Operations Research from the Sloan School of Management at MIT in 1985, and the Ph.D. in Electrical Engineering and Computer Science from MIT, where he was affiliated with the Laboratory for Information and Decision Systems. After obtaining hisdoctorate, Dr. Parekh was a postdoc with the MIT Laboratory for Computer Sciences. Before coming to the EECS Department at U.C. Berkeley as an Adjunct Professor in 2003, Dr. Parekh spent a number of years in industry (AT&T; the T. J. Watson Research Center; IBM Research; Sun Microsystems) working on various research problems, mostly in the area of computer networking. He was co-founder as well as President and CEO of San Francisco-based FastForward Networks which developed products to enable the large-scale distribution of broadcast video on the Internet. In 2000, FastForward Networks was sold to Inktomi, where its technology and products formed the basis of Inktomi's content networking offerings. After the merger, Dr. Parekh remained with Inktomi for a brief time as General Manager of the Media Products Division. From 2002 he has been associated with Accel Partners, an early stage venture capital firm as a Venture Partner. He currently the CEO of Lytmus Inc., an early-stage San Francisco-based company.
